How they compare
Poland currently reports 12.75 % change on previous year against 12.31 % change on previous year in Mauritania, a difference of 0.44 % change on previous year.
The two have swapped places 12 times across 30 shared years of data; in 1996 it was Poland ahead.
Mauritania ranks 68th and Poland ranks 65th of 179 countries.
Across the 4 decades both report, Mauritania averaged higher in 2 and Poland in 2.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Mauritania | Poland |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1990s | -8.01 % change on previous year | 13.74 % change on previous year | 21.76 % change on previous year | Poland |
| 2000s | 12.52 % change on previous year | 10.16 % change on previous year | 2.35 % change on previous year | Mauritania |
| 2010s | 4.23 % change on previous year | 2.45 % change on previous year | 1.78 % change on previous year | Mauritania |
| 2020s | 5.25 % change on previous year | 7.79 % change on previous year | 2.54 % change on previous year | Poland |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
